Thesis Abstract

Abstract
This thesis explores the impact of plant-based diets on cardiovascular health in young adults. The study aims to investigate the potential benefits of plant-based diets in reducing the risk factors associated with cardiovascular diseases among young adults. The research design includes a comprehensive review of existing literature on plant-based diets and cardiovascular health, followed by a detailed analysis of the dietary patterns and cardiovascular outcomes in a sample of young adults. The methodology involves a mixed-methods approach, combining quantitative analysis of dietary intake and cardiovascular health markers with qualitative interviews to explore perceptions and behaviors related to plant-based diets. The findings from the literature review reveal a growing body of evidence supporting the cardiovascular benefits of plant-based diets, including improvements in blood pressure, cholesterol levels, and inflammatory markers. However, there is limited research specifically focusing on the impact of plant-based diets on cardiovascular health in young adults. The research methodology includes a cross-sectional study of young adults aged 18-30 years, assessing their dietary patterns and cardiovascular risk factors through surveys and biomarker analysis. The results of the study show that young adults who follow plant-based diets have lower levels of cholesterol and blood pressure compared to those with non-plant-based diets. Furthermore, participants who consume higher amounts of plant-based foods exhibit better cardiovascular health outcomes, including reduced inflammation and improved endothelial function. Qualitative findings suggest that young adults perceive plant-based diets as beneficial for both personal health and environmental sustainability. Overall, this thesis contributes to the existing literature by highlighting the potential benefits of plant-based diets in promoting cardiovascular health among young adults. The findings support the notion that plant-based diets can be a valuable dietary strategy for reducing the risk of cardiovascular diseases in this population. The implications of this research underscore the importance of promoting plant-based dietary patterns as a preventive measure for cardiovascular health in young adults.

Thesis Overview

The project titled "Exploring the Impact of Plant-Based Diets on Cardiovascular Health in Young Adults" aims to investigate the relationship between plant-based diets and cardiovascular health in the young adult population. This research overview will delve into the rationale behind the study, the significance of the topic, the objectives of the research, and the methodology that will be employed to achieve these objectives. **Rationale for the Study:** Cardiovascular diseases (CVDs) are a leading cause of mortality worldwide, and lifestyle factors, including diet, play a crucial role in the development and prevention of these conditions. Plant-based diets, characterized by a high intake of fruits, vegetables, whole grains, nuts, and seeds, have been associated with a reduced risk of CVDs. However, there is a need to explore the specific impact of plant-based diets on cardiovascular health in the young adult population, as this demographic group may benefit significantly from dietary interventions to prevent long-term health complications. **Significance of the Topic:** Understanding the effects of plant-based diets on cardiovascular health in young adults is essential for public health initiatives aimed at reducing the burden of CVDs in this age group. By identifying the potential benefits of plant-based diets, healthcare professionals can provide evidence-based dietary recommendations to promote heart health and overall well-being among young adults. Additionally, this research can contribute to the existing body of knowledge on nutrition and cardiovascular disease prevention. **Objectives of the Research:** 1. To assess the current dietary patterns of young adults in relation to plant-based food consumption. 2. To investigate the impact of plant-based diets on cardiovascular risk factors, such as blood pressure, cholesterol levels, and body weight, in young adults. 3. To explore the association between plant-based diets and markers of cardiovascular health, including inflammation and oxidative stress. 4. To examine the potential barriers and facilitators to adopting and maintaining a plant-based diet among young adults. **Methodology:** The research will employ a mixed-methods approach, combining quantitative surveys and qualitative interviews to gather data on dietary habits, cardiovascular health parameters, and perceptions of plant-based diets among young adults. A cross-sectional study design will be used to assess the relationship between plant-based diets and cardiovascular risk factors. Statistical analyses, including regression modeling and correlation analyses, will be conducted to explore these associations. Qualitative data from interviews will be thematically analyzed to identify key themes related to diet preferences, motivations for dietary choices, and perceived barriers to adopting plant-based diets. In conclusion, this research project on "Exploring the Impact of Plant-Based Diets on Cardiovascular Health in Young Adults" seeks to contribute valuable insights into the role of plant-based diets in promoting cardiovascular health among young adults. By shedding light on the potential benefits and challenges associated with plant-based eating patterns, this study aims to inform public health strategies and empower young adults to make informed dietary choices for long-term heart health and well-being.
